Canadian Football Stadium Transformed Into Snowboard Big Air World Cup Stop

Football stadium transformed for Snowboard Big Air world cup stop

The Style Experience, Canada’s first-ever Snowboard FIS World Cup Stadium Big Air event is heading to Edmonton’s Commonwealth Stadium this weekend. Part of Canada’s Shred the North Series, it will be the first North American stop on the 2022/2023 FIS World Tour. “Flyin’ Brian” Rice Competes in World Cup and Has High Hopes to Soar Into Olympics

Aspen CO

“Flyin’ Brian” Rice competed in the FIS Snowboarding Big Air World Cup in Chur, Switzerland this past October. The seventeen-year-old is confident he will become the first black snowboarder on the US Olympic team according to an article written by Shauna Farnell in the New York Times (2021).
